OnWorks Linux ו-Windows Online WorkStations

לוגו

אירוח מקוון בחינם עבור תחנות עבודה

<הקודם | תוכן | הבא>

6.13. קונסולות


למכולות יש מספר קונסולות שניתן להגדרה. אחד תמיד קיים על המכולה /dev/console. זה מוצג בטרמינל שממנו רצתם lxc-start, אלא אם כן ה -d אפשרות מוגדרת. הפלט מופעל / dev /


לנחם ניתן להפנות לקובץ באמצעות ה -c console-file אפשרות ל lxc-start. מספר הקונסולות הנוספות מצוין על ידי lxc.tty משתנה, ובדרך כלל מוגדר ל-4. הקונסולות האלה מוצגות ב- /dev/ttyN (עבור 1 <= N <= 4). כדי להיכנס למסוף 3 מהמארח, השתמש ב:


sudo lxc-console -n container -t 3


או אם -ט נ האפשרות לא צוינה, קונסולה שאינה בשימוש תיבחר אוטומטית. כדי לצאת מהמסוף, השתמש ברצף הבריחה Ctrl-a q. שימו לב שרצף הבריחה לא עובד בקונסולה כתוצאה מ lxc- התחל בלי ה -d אוֹפְּצִיָה.


כל קונסולת מיכל היא למעשה Unix98 pty ב-pty של המארח (לא של האורח), המותקנת על גבי האורח. /dev/ttyN ו /dev/console. לכן, אם האורח מבטל את הטעינה של אלה או מנסה בדרך אחרת לגשת למכשיר הדמות בפועל 4: נ, הוא לא יגיש את ה-getty לקונסולות LXC. (עם הגדרות ברירת המחדל, הקונטיינר לא יוכל לגשת לאותו התקן דמות ולכן getty ייכשל.) זה יכול לקרות בקלות כאשר סקריפט אתחול מעלה באופן עיוור חדש / dev.


מחשוב ענן מערכת ההפעלה המוביל ב-OnWorks: